Part C: Case Study Design WAN Infrastructure John is a System Administrator in Aus Tech. Pty Ltd. The company in this case study has offices in Sydney, Melbourne and Brisbane. Each of these offices has three own Local Area Networks (LANS). The company wants to connect their three offices in a WAN so that they can communicate with each other. John was advised by his manager to prepare blueprints of requirements which show how these offices can be connected with each other. What are the options they have and what is the best option? John decides to make a team that compiles a list of equipment and apparatus which is needed for this project. You are a member of John's team and he has asked you to prepare a document to implement WAN for a specific workplace or simulated workplace. Each document is required to demonstrate technical and cost-effective plans and procedures. Task: Describe the most appropriate technologies and protocols that should be used for the WAN. Decide the Internet Service provider (ISP) according to the bandwidth requirements of the company. You may extend the information provided in the published scenarios in order to justify your solution. Area to explore: Switched circuits, leased lines, T-carrier, Synchronous optical network (SONET), high-speed digital subscriber line (HDSL).
